A transponder key has a chip inside that is programmed specifically to your car. This allows your car and key to communicate through radio transmission, in most cases.     The side impact collision, also called the T-bone accident, is one of the most deadly types of accidents. If the collision occurs at a side door, the door offers the driver or passenger little in the way of protection. Unlike the front or rear of the car, it has little structural strength to resist high impact forces. It also lacks a lengthy crumple zone to absorb energy.
